How Our Team Restores Your Laundry Room
A proper restoration process is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ring a safe living environment. Our team follows a meticulous approach that includes:
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our technicians will evaluate the extent of the damage, identifying the source of the leak and assessing the affected area. They’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ture and signs of mold growth. Within 60 minutes, you’ll have a clear understanding of the situation and our plan to address it.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our crew will use industrial-grade pumps and wet/dry vacuums to remove standing water and excess moisture from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will employ specialized drying equipment to remove moisture from the air, ensuring your laundry room is dry and safe. This process may take 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use EPA-registered cleaning products to sanitize and disinfect the affected area, removing any remaining bacteria, viruses, or mold spores. This step is essential in preventing health risks and ensuring a safe living environment.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Our crew will work with you to repair or replace damaged materials, ensuring your laundry room is restored to its original condition. We’ll also provide guidance on how to prevent future water damage and recommend any necessary maintenance or upgrades.

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ration Cost in Venice Gardens, FL
The cost of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ration in Venice Gardens, FL,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ing the situation. Here’s a rough breakdown of what you might expect: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Type of cleaning products needed, extent of contamination |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ials needed |
Keep in mind that these estimates are rough and may v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a detailed estimate after assessing the damage and discussing your needs with you.

Q: Can I prevent water damage in my laundry room?
A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ent water damage in your laundry room. Regular maintenance, such as checking for leaks and ensuring proper drainage, can help prevent issues. Also, using a water-detecting device or installing a smart water sensor can provide early warning signs of potential problems.
